Cooper Clinic installs low-radiation CT scanner

by The City Wire staff ([email protected]) 73 views 

Fort Smith-based Cooper Clinic recently installed the GE LightSpeed VCT XTe CT scanner. Commonly referred to as “cat scan” or CT, new software in the computed tomography equipment provides substantially lower levels of radiation compared to conventional CT scans, according to a Cooper Clinic release.

The radiation dosage is generally reduced by up to 40%, but heart scan radiation dosage may be reduced by as much as 80%.

Computed Tomography (CT) is the diagnostic exam commonly ordered when a physician suspects a medical problem that is not easily detectable with a conventional physical examination or tests. In the Fort Smith area, lower radiation CT is only available at Cooper Clinic.

The Cooper Clinic CT Department is located at the Main Clinic on Rogers Avenue and is staffed by three registered CT Technologists.

Cooper Clinic physicians practice in 25 specialties at 17 locations.
